Navigating the Ethical Maze

With great power comes great responsibility. The rapid adoption of AI has thrown critical ethical challenges into the spotlight.

Ethical Concern The Challenge
Bias and Discrimination AI models trained on incomplete or biased data can perpetuate and even amplify real-world societal biases (e.g., around gender or race), leading to unfair or discriminatory outcomes.
Transparency (The “Black Box”) Many complex AI models are opaque—it’s nearly impossible to know exactly why a system arrived at a particular decision, making it difficult to control, monitor, or correct.
Intellectual Property (IP) Questions of ownership remain a legal gray area. Who owns the rights to AI-generated art or text—the user, the AI developer, or the original content creators whose work was used for training?
Accountability and Control As AI makes more critical decisions (e.g., in finance or autonomous vehicles), establishing clear lines of responsibility and ensuring ultimate human oversight is paramount.

Addressing these concerns requires a commitment to responsible AI development. Principles like fairness, explainability, privacy protection, and robust human oversight must be integrated into the design and deployment of every AI system.

What Is Multimodal AI?

Traditionally, AI models have been trained to work with one type of input at a time. For instance, a natural language processing model might be excellent at analyzing text, while a computer vision model focuses solely on images.

Multimodal AI, on the other hand, blends these input types into a single system. That means it can take in a picture and a question about the picture, understand both, and respond accurately. Or it can watch a video, read accompanying subtitles, and interpret the tone of voice—all at once.

This cross-sensory learning allows for much richer, more context-aware outputs.

Leading Technologies in Multimodal AI

In 2025, several leading AI models are pushing the boundaries of what’s possible:

  • OpenAI’s GPT-4o is one example of a large multimodal model that can reason across text, image, and audio seamlessly.

  • Google’s Gemini and Meta’s ImageBind are also exploring deep integration across different types of data.

These systems are not only multimodal in input and output—they’re also cross-modal, meaning they can reason across modalities. For instance, they can connect an image to a written story or derive audio context from a video clip.

Understanding AI: The Basics

At its core, Artificial Intelligence refers to the ability of machines or software to mimic humanintelligence. This includes learning from experience (machine learning), understanding language (natural language processing), recognizing patterns, and making decisions. AI systems are powered by algorithms and vast amounts of data, enabling them to perform tasks that typically require human intellect.

But AI isn’t just one technology—it’s an umbrella term that covers various subfields, such as:

  • Machine Learning (ML): A method of AI where algorithms learn from data without explicit programming.

  • Deep Learning: A subset of ML that mimics the human brain through artificial neural networks to solve complex problems.

  • Natural Language Processing (NLP): The ability of machines to understand and respond to human language in a meaningful way.

  • Computer Vision: The capability of machines to interpret and make decisions based on visual data (e.g., recognizing objects in images).

AI in Healthcare: A Game Changer

One of the most promising areas where AI is making an impact is healthcare. AI-powered systems are revolutionizing diagnostics, treatment planning, and patient care. For instance, machine learning algorithms are already capable of analyzing medical images with incredible accuracy, identifying early signs of diseases like cancer or heart conditions that might be missed by human doctors.

Furthermore, AI is accelerating drug discovery. By analyzing vast datasets of molecular structures and patient outcomes, AI can identify potential drug candidates more quickly and efficiently than traditional methods. AI is also being used to personalize treatment plans, ensuring that patients receive therapies tailored to their unique genetic profiles.

Types of AI

AI can be broadly categorized into three types:

  1. Narrow AI
    Also known as “Weak AI,” this type is designed to perform a specific task. Most of the AI we see today falls into this category — like facial recognition software or spam filters.

  2. General AI
    This is a more advanced form of AI that can understand, learn, and apply knowledge across a wide range of tasks — much like a human being. It’s still theoretical but is a major goal for researchers.

  3. Superintelligent AI
    A hypothetical form of AI that surpasses human intelligence in every aspect. While it’s a popular theme in movies and literature, it’s still far from reality.

What is AI? A Simple Breakdown

At its core, AI is about giving machines the ability to perform tasks that typically require humanintelligence. This includes things like learning, reasoning, problem-solving, and perception. It’s a broad field that encompasses various techniques and disciplines.

The most common form of AI we encounter today is “narrow AI,” which is designed to perform a specific, limited set of actions. Think of a chess-playing computer, a spam filter for your email, or a self-driving car. These systems are incredibly good at their assigned tasks but can’t perform functions outside their programming.

Key concepts in AI include:

  • Machine Learning (ML): This is a subset of AI that uses algorithms to allow computers to learn from data without being explicitly programmed. By feeding an ML model a large dataset, it can identify patterns and make predictions.

  • Natural Language Processing (NLP): This is the technology that enables computers to understand, interpret, and generate human language. It’s what powers chatbots, language translation tools, and virtual assistants like Siri and Alexa.

  • Computer Vision: This field allows computers to “see” and interpret visual information from images and videos. It’s used in everything from facial recognition to medical image analysis.
